Note: The job is a remote job and is open to candidates in USA. The AES Corporation is a Fortune 500 company leading the charge in the global energy revolution. They are seeking a Cyber Security Analyst II to provide technical leadership in data protection, ensuring effective incident response, documentation, and compliance with data protection standards.
Responsibilities
• Provide technical leadership for detection and response workflows by triaging data protection events, validating true positives, conducting root cause analysis, and driving containment and remediation actions with stakeholders
• Maintain and refine processes and procedures for effective data protection, including incident response plans and data classification schemes
• Ensure comprehensive documentation of data protection measures, procedures, metrics and training materials is maintained and regularly updated
• Drive data protection awareness and education programs across the organization to promote a secure data handling culture
• Collaborate with cross-functional teams to align data protection strategies with organizational goals and regulatory requirements
• Support the evaluation of emerging data protection technologies and best practices to enhance the organization’s security infrastructure
• Oversee the development and implementation of data governance frameworks to ensure compliance with data protection standards, laws and regulations
• Support the maintenance of data protection dashboards and reports by defining metrics and data requirements, integrating relevant telemetry to ensure data quality and consistency
• Conduct regular reviews of data access controls and policies to align with enterprise standards and regulations
• Facilitate cross-departmental collaboration to ensure data quality and consistency across the organization
• Support create and standardize data protection processes to prevent, detect, and respond to potential data breaches
• Develop and maintain training programs and procedures to ensure AES People are knowledgeable in data protection best practices
• Implement continuous improvement practices to enhance data protection measures and adapt to evolving threats
• Monitor and support reporting on the effectiveness of data protection strategies to senior management and stakeholders
• Provide guidance on data protection impact assessments for new projects or technologies
• Support the response to data protection incidents, ensuring timely reporting and resolution in accordance with SLA’s, legal and regulatory obligations
• Establish and enforce data governance policies to manage enterprise data effectively
Skills
• Minimum of 4 years of experience working within a security organization, ideally with a focus on process and governance oversight
• A candidate must possess an analytical mindset to support the continuous optimization of Data Loss Prevention (DLP) and Insider Threat processes and procedures through automation and other optimization techniques
• Proven experience in leading cyber security initiatives
• Knowledge of SIEM/SOAR technologies, Microsoft security tools, and enterprise proxy solutions for DLP and insider risk management
• Understanding of data protection laws and regulations, such as GDPR, CCPA, etc
• Exceptional communication skills, capable of effectively engaging with both technical and non-technical audiences on data protection issues
• Knowledge of data lifecycle management, data classification, and data governance principles and practices
• Strong organizational skills, with the ability to manage and take ownership of multiple priorities in a dynamic environment
• Candidate must have experience as an analyst on an Insider Threat, Security Operation Center (SOC), or Incident Response (IR) team
• Advanced certifications in data protection, privacy, or security domains, such as CIPP/E, CIPT, CIPM, CISM, CISSP, etc
• Comprehensive knowledge of data protection regulations and frameworks (GDPR, CCPA, NIST, ISO 27001, etc.)
• Ability to coordinate data protection assessments and audits
• Exceptional analytical and problem-solving abilities
• Proven track record of successful collaboration with cross-functional teams and executive stakeholders
• Basic understanding of Operational Technology environments
